If the gasoline pipeline which feeds 1/3 the USA goes boom, what would one expect gasoline futures to do? Go down? No. Less supply, so prices jack up. Which they did. Not sure why there is an argument here about the movement of price.
Now, let's follow this through logically. This week's CL numbers will reflect last week. But next week's number may show an increased CL demand because of all the gasoline lost in yesterday's explosion, so refiners need to consume more crude to refine to petrol. And petrol inventories should show a decrease. However, we still have the OPEC meeting hanging over our heads at end of month, and Iran/Iraq are starting to waffle on the production-cut deal. So what can be gleaned from these facts? Go long short-term (next two weeks) then stay out before meeting? Tough call.
